The National and Haim to perform at new BBC 6 Music festival

The National and Haim have been confirmed for the inaugural BBC 6 Music Festival.

The radio station announced today (January 21) that they will be holding a two-day shindig at the Victoria Warehouse in Manchester on February 28 and March 1.

They have now confirmed that The National will play the Stage 1 on March 1 whilst US trio Haim will perform on the same stage on February 28.

Metronomy, Drenge and Jimi Goodwin meanwhile will play Stage 2 on the first night and James Blake will also play the second second on the next night.

Over 30 artists and DJs will perform in total over the two days and more announcements are due soon.

Tickets for the event will go on sale from Friday (January 24).
